Storm and Matt discuss the ongoing crime wave across the country being carried out by illegal immigrants, all thanks to Joe Biden and Democrats' open border policies. They also discuss the latest news out of Congress, the big fight conservatives have ahead as the 2024 Election looms, and much more.
